Welcome aboard AMBAR, a 2022 Sanlorenzo SL120A Asymmetric, a 120-foot motor yacht that perfectly represents Sanlorenzo’s signature blend of Italian design, architectural innovation, and true superyacht volume.
Designed with the brand’s celebrated asymmetric wide-body layout, this SL120A delivers exceptional interior space, seamless circulation, and a sense of scale more commonly found on yachts approaching 40 meters — while remaining highly practical and owner-friendly.
With a shallow draft of approximately 6’9”, she is exceptionally well-suited for Bahamas cruising, allowing comfortable access to shallow anchorages and island destinations without compromise. Powered by twin MTU 16V 2000 engines producing 2,637 HP each, the yacht cruises efficiently at approximately 23 knots, with the ability to reach up to 27 knots when desired.

Moving forward into the main salon, the yacht’s asymmetric concept reveals itself in a subtle but powerful way. By shifting the side deck to port, the interior gains a sense of width and openness that is immediately perceptible. The salon feels expansive and light-filled, with full-height windows drawing daylight deep into the space and maintaining a constant visual connection with the sea.
